IFAS: Security

IFAS security is designed to operate in a multi-user environment. The system provides many security safeguards at the logical, database, and demographic level; centralizes system information; provides an extremely convenient tool for the analyst to create user/job interface dialogue; automatically interfaces systems to users by conducting menu-driven job request dialogue; launches background jobs and activates tasks interactively; and creates a standard structure for interfacing user-given parameters to applications programs.

Security Safeguards

  • Restrict access to operating commands by users.
  • Define job running and database access capabilities.
  • Restrict read, write, and update access at the entry level; i.e., you may allow access to only a designated set of entries (records or rows) in a given data set.
  • Force password to change at user-defined intervals.
  • Assign user access to designated printers with an optional maximum print priority specified for each printer.
  • Define job security to grant user access to only selected menus.
  • Define logging of user-requested functions at the global, user, or job level.
  • Require re-entry of password for periods of inactivity on workstations.

Person/Entity System Overview

The Person/Entity System maintains person and entity name and address information in a central database. This database can then be used by all application software needing to access such information. The advantages of centralizing such information are primarily data consistency, accuracy, and enhanced control. All update and extraction software is provided with the system; plus, a powerful interactive PEDB INQUIRY facility is included. Because the client may define desired attributes and associate them with entries in the PEDB, this is a comprehensive database.

Major Features

  • Associate multiple addresses and free form text with each entry.
  • Associate any special codes with entries and then extract from the database using these codes as selection criteria. There is no limit on number of codes associated.
  • Assign users with read, write and/or update access to selected entries in the database using built-in security and control system.
  • Automatically maintain a log of what has been changed, when and by whom. Choose to keep old name and address details in the database after they have been changed (this is useful for billing systems or other systems which need to keep track of changes).
  • Support generic searches on multiple factors with powerful online Person/Entity database INQUIRY facility.
  • Select and print file listings based upon multiple selection criteria.
  • Select and print user-defined address labels based upon multiple selection criteria.
  • Supports codes to track minority businesses.
  • System is easily interfaced to existing software.
